 Programming 
 
 
 
For most installations the LPA-Series receiver can be programmed in the field 
without the need for Ritron PC Programmer 12.0.1.  Field programming is 
accomplished in 3 easy steps.  First, the radio frequency and tone codes are 
entered.  Second, the selective signaling code is entered (if used).  Third, the LPA-
Series options and volume setting are entered.

Enter a 2-digit Frequency code from Table 1 and a 2-digit QC code from Table 2 or 
nter a 2-digit Frequency code from Table 1 and a 3-digit DQC code from Table 3. 
E
 
or
 
Enter a 2-digit, 2-Tone Paging code from Table 4 
Enter any 3 –  digit Selcall Paging Code. 
7-
 
E
nte a 2-digit Feature code from Table 5 to: 
  Enable or disable a Pre-Announce Tone.  
  Enable or disable Record and Play operation. 
  Enable or disable Weather Alert feature (VHF models only) 
  Reset LPA-Series receiver to Factory default programming. 
 
Enter the desired Speaker Volume Level as a 2 –digit number from 05 – 99. 
 
 
Enter the 1-digit NOAA Weather Frequency code from Table 6 (VHF models only)   
This only programs the NOAA weather frequency, the Weather Alert feature must be enabled using 
the Special Features code in Table 5.
